Leaking Pipe Water Damage Repair in Goodlettsville, TN
Slow leaks are often more destructive than burst pipes — silently saturating insulation, framing, and drywall for weeks before becoming visible. Warning signs in your Goodlettsville home include unexplained water bill increases, musty odors, bubbling or stained walls or ceilings, warped floors, and soft spots near plumbing. TrustPoint uses thermal imaging cameras and professional moisture meters to locate every inch of hidden damage — then dries it completely before mold establishes.
Ceiling Water Damage Repair in Goodlettsville, TN
A sagging, stained, or dripping ceiling is a structural emergency. Whether caused by a burst pipe above, storm damage, a leaking appliance, or HVAC condensation, ceiling water damage requires immediate professional response. Wet drywall can collapse without warning, and moisture trapped in ceiling insulation and framing creates ideal mold conditions within 24 to 48 hours in Middle Tennessee’s humid climate.

Does homeowners insurance cover water damage in Goodlettsville?
Most policies cover sudden, accidental damage such as burst pipes or appliance failures. We document all damage, communicate directly with your adjuster, and handle insurance billing on your behalf.
How do I know if I have a burst pipe or hidden leak in my Goodlettsville home?
Signs include sudden pressure loss, unexplained water bill increases, musty odors, stained or bubbling walls, and warped floors. Call TrustPoint — we use thermal imaging to find hidden moisture your eyes cannot.
How fast can mold grow after ceiling or pipe water damage in Goodlettsville?
In Middle Tennessee’s humidity, mold can begin growing within 24 to 48 hours. Professional drying equipment removes structural moisture far faster than consumer fans — which is why immediate response is critical.
